Problem

Existing passenger transport vehicle seat systems lack a practical, safe, and ergonomic solution for easily adjusting seat heights and configurations to accommodate varying passenger loads while maintaining safety and facilitating maintenance.

Innovation Solution

A sliding seat system with a mobile seat that can be adjusted in height relative to a fixed seat using a jack and sliding mechanism, allowing lateral and circular translational movements, and locking mechanisms to secure the seat in both folded and unfolded positions without protruding beyond the fixed seat, enabling easy cleaning and configuration changes.

The present invention concerns a sliding seat system (20) for a passenger transport vehicle, comprising a base (22) attached to a body shell (10) of the vehicle (1), a fixed seat (30) arranged on the base (22) and provided to receive a first passenger, a mobile seat (40) movable between, on one hand, a folded position in which this mobile seat (40) is retracted relative to the fixed seat (30) and, on the other hand, an unfolded position (20B) in which this mobile seat (40) is arranged next to the fixed seat (30) so as to receive a second passenger, and an actuating device (60) configured to move the mobile seat (40) between the folded position and the unfolded position (20B). This system (20) is characterized in that the actuating device (60) comprises means for aligning the height of the mobile seat (40) in the unfolded position (20B) relative to the fixed seat (30). The invention also relates to a passenger transport vehicle equipped with at least one sliding seat system (20) as mentioned above.
